First Step of Australia PR pathways for students: Decide What is Your Nominated Occupation

While you have completed your degree in Australia, it’s time to decide what your nominated occupation is. It is important to decide in the first place because it will show the options for your Australian PR pathway.

It is best to decide a nominated occupation that suits your degree because most of the skilled occupations in Australia require you to have the relevant or closely relevant education background. Make sure that your nominated occupation is listed in the Australian Skilled Occupation List.

Second Step of Australia PR pathways for students: Obtain Temporary Graduate Visa (subclass 485)

Temporary Graduate Visa (subclass 485) plays an important role in your way to obtain the Australian PR, because the 485 visa will help you in either obtaining a higher points for the GSM program or in meeting the criteria for ENS program visa, through:

  • Obtaining the required work experiences for your occupation;
  • Fulfilling the residency requirements if you aim to lodge a regional skilled work visa; and
  • Training your English ability.

With these 3 aspects, you will have a broader chance to apply for the Australian work visa which either has the direct Permanent Residency pathway or not.

Third Step of Australia PR pathways for Students: Get Your Australian Work Visa Application Ready

Now you have obtained the required work experience, fulfill the residency requirements and get the best score for your English language test. It is time to get your Australian PR application ready. The most common way is by applying for an Australian work visa.

Your Australian work visa application must be ready before your Temporary Graduate Visa (subclass 485) expires. Two of the following work visa programs can be your option:

General Skilled Migration Program

The General Skilled Migration Program offers three different visa subclasses, including 190 visa, 189 visa and 491 visa.

These visa subclasses work with a point-test scheme, in which you must obtain at least 65 points on your Expression of Interest application. These points are derived from several aspects, such as age, work experience, qualifications, English language proficiency, etc.

This program can be your way to get Australian PR, as long as you can obtain the point.

The plus point from these visa subclasses is that Visa 189 and Visa 190 offers you a direct permanent residency, meaning that you don’t need to apply for another temporary work visa.

Employer Sponsored Visa

The Employer Sponsored Visa offers some different visa subclasses with different streams, such as 482 visa186 visa, and 494 visa.

These visa subclasses work with sponsorship schemes. So, you must receive a sponsorship offer from the Australian company, either in a non-regional or regional area, to work for the company in order to obtain the Australian PR.

Other important information: Covid-19 Visa Concession is Over

You might have heard about this and it surely affects your migration plan. While previously the concession in meeting the work experience and age criteria were still in place, now you have to consider everything carefully and use your time in Australia wisely.

These recent changes require a more careful approach in the migration plan. The new criteria especially for work experience and age are affecting international students looking for work visas.

For example, subclass 408 visa used to be another option for people who couldn’t apply for a subclass 485 visa or needed more time on it to get work experience. With the covid-19 visa concession closure, lesser visa options are available. And therefore, it is crucial to plan things carefully and starting the migration process early is very important to avoid any setbacks to ensure that the updated rules are met and smooth transition to life in Australia is achieved.
